December is a busy month for many people, with holiday plans and family gatherings. But don’t let that stop you from sending out your newsletter! Here are some ideas to help you get started:
– Send out a newsletter with a festive theme. Maybe feature a festive cartoon, or write about the best holiday traditions around.
– Offer seasonal discounts on products or services.
– Share interesting holiday stories or recipes.
– Send out a reminder about upcoming events or webinars related to your industry.
– Thank your subscribers for their support throughout the year and offer them a discount on next year’s subscription.

What Do You Write in a Newsletter for November?
In November, you might want to send out a newsletter focused on gratitude. Research has shown that writing about what you are grateful for can help you feel happier and less stressed. You could write a few paragraphs about what you are grateful for this month, or you could include a list of things that make you happy.

What Do You Say in a Christmas Newsletter?
When writing a Christmas newsletter, it is important to keep in mind the Target audience. The newsletter may be for the employees of a company, or it may be for the customers of a company. The tone of the newsletter should be festive and encouraging.
